ELECTION NOTES.

(By Telegraph.—Own Correspondent.)

TAURANGA, this day,

Mr D. Lundon addressed the electors of Tauranga in the Theatre Royal last night, 400 being present. It was the mostf orderly meeting ever held in Tauranga, The Mayor was in the chair. Mr Lundon's address took over two hours, and was very well received by the audience. A few questions were asked and replied to. Mr Lundon received a unanimous vote of thanks and confidence, carried with cheering. Mr Lundon speaks at Te Puke to-night. He spoke at Katikati on Friday, also at Tepuna on Saturday night. He had" a full,- meeting there and a-tmanimous vote of thanks and confidence was carried.
